             Falmouth Single Family Home Sales from Cape Cod's Multiple Listing Service Complied 2/1/08January, 2008December, 2007 January, 2007Houses sold              20  26              31Lowest price$263,950 $152,000$190,000Highest Price$2,800,000 $1,100,000$2,055,00Average Sale Price         $547,258                     $497,812$485,000Avg. Days On Market179 18595% sale price / list price 94.2793.4493.33%    # On The Market                             389                                    430                                     414 On average, sellers reduced their original list prices by 8% to get their properties sold. (Down from 12% last month) 5 sales of the 20 were for the full list price ( 1 went over list)   103 new listings 57 came under agreement104 price reductions

Complied 1/2/08December, 2007November 2007December, 2006Houses sold               2637               38Lowest price$152,000$230,000$213.000Highest Price$1,100,000$2,050,000$11,325.000Average Sale Price     $497,812      $547,615$795,000Avg. Days On Market185121142% sale price / list price93.4493.29%94.93% On average, sellers reduced their original list prices by 12% to get their properties sold.  Trend to watch: the Cape Cod MLS reports 386 Single Family homes on the market in Falmouth which is down 32% from the high inventory of fall '06 where we had 566 homes on the market.   In Falmouth during December, the Cape Cod MLS reports this activity for single family homes:35 new listings 37 came under agreement83 price reductions Falmouth Ma Real Estate, Cape Cod Real Estate, Cape Cod Forec...

The headline in today's USA Today prompted me to post this information. The headline: "Home prices plunge further: Declines likely to go on as sales fall." Since all real estate is local, I thought I would post the following report. It is reprinted directly from the Barnstable County (Cape Cod, MA) Registry of Deeds website and it gives a good overview of the current housing market on the Cape. VOLUME FLAT, VALUE DIPS!Barnstable County Register of Deeds, John F. Meade, reports that the volume of real estate sales in October 2007 was down 0.2% from October 2006 volume and the total value of sales was up 3.5% from the previous year.  The median individual property sale value was down 7.6% from the previous year.  There was a 28.1% decrease in the volume of mortgage activity from October 2...
